Mission
What you will drive
Core responsibilities:
- Support the Business for Water Stewardship team by helping identify and fund high-impact water stewardship projects and managing systems to track and communicate project progress
- Provide technical administrative support for project research, scoping, management, and reporting including preparing documents, supporting partners, and conducting watershed research
- Manage and refine systems for tracking projects, project leads, funding contributions, progress toward volumetric targets, and client project portfolios
- Draft and maintain internal templates, processes, and procedures for data, research, and project tracking and management

About
Inside Bonneville Environmental Foundation
Bonneville Environmental Foundation (BEF) is an entrepreneurial nonprofit working on environmental solutions at the intersection of renewable energy and freshwater, building long-term partnerships to achieve real, measurable environmental benefits.
